MELBOURNE, Australia March, 2012 – The revolutionary upside down ice cube tray, created by Qubies, was originally designed to store and freeze breast milk in portions that were easy to remove from the container. But the creator never expected the overwhelming enthusiasm and demand she has since received from mums across Australia, thanking her for solving this frustrating feeding problem. www.qubies.com.au/

Time-poor mums who want to prepare healthy, varied and balanced food for their babies used to have two options – buy canned food that was ‘supposedly’ healthy or, if they wanted to know exactly what was going into their babies mouths, prepare their own baby food purees fresh every day. But with sleep deprivation, nappy changes, establishing routines and even struggling to get to the shower some days, the thought of preparing fresh food daily held little appeal for tired mums – and was especially true for Qubies inventor Alexandra Wardle after the birth of her first son. After battling with one too many containers of frozen purees Alexandra had a revelation, Qubies the time-saver was born, and mums around Australia have been thanking her ever since.

Mums are now able to prepare batches of fresh food in advance, pour the contents into the slim-lined tray, secure the lid which automatically divides the contents into 30ml serves and simply remove them from the fridge or freezer fresh whenever little loved ones’ are hungry. Creative mums are even using Qubies for other uses including freezing breast milk, mini desserts, excess lemon juice, pestos, passionfruit pulp, egg whites, condensed milk, left over wine and gravies – Qubies ice cube tray is a multitasking supermum tool for storing all kinds of food.

Qubies containers are BPA free with soft silicon dividing lids that fit snugly to avoid spillage and yet are flexible enough to allow a quick twist to be all that’s needed to release the yummy fresh contents from the container when hurriedly preparing a meal with a hungry baby on the hip.
